What is MemMachine?
MemMachine is an open-source **long-term memory layer** for AI agents and LLM-powered applications. It enables your AI to **learn, store, and recall** information from past sessions—transforming stateless chatbots into personalized, context-aware assistants.
Key Capabilities
**Episodic Memory**: Graph-based conversational context that persists across sessions
**Profile Memory**: Long-term user facts and preferences stored in SQL
**Working Memory**: Short-term context for the current session
**Agent Memory Persistence**: Memory that survives restarts, sessions, and even model changes

Key Features
**Multiple Memory Types**: Working (short-term), Episodic (long-term conversational), and Profile (user facts) memory
**Developer-Friendly APIs**: Python SDK, RESTful API, TypeScript SDK, and MCP server interfaces
**Flexible Storage**: Graph database (Neo4j) for episodic memory, SQL for profiles
**LLM Agnostic**: Works with OpenAI, Anthropic, Bedrock, Ollama, and any LLM provider
**Self-Hosted or Cloud**: Run locally, in Docker, or use our managed service

Architecture
<div align="center">
!MemMachine Architecture
</div>
**Agents interact via the API Layer**: Users interact with an agent, which connects to MemMachine through a RESTful API, Python SDK, or MCP Server.
**MemMachine manages memory**: Processes interactions and stores them as Episodic Memory (conversational context) and Profile Memory (long-term user facts).
**Data is persisted**: Episodic memory is stored in a graph database; profile memory is stored in SQL.
